复古传奇服务器配置全攻略:硬件选型带宽规划与稳定运行实用方案

来源: 作者: 点击:
在复古传奇私人服务器的运营中,服务器配置如同玛法大陆的根基,直接决定着玩家的游戏体验。过低的配置会导致地图卡顿、技能延迟,甚至服务器崩溃;而盲目追求高配置则会造成资源浪费。特别是对于 1.76 等经典复古版本,其 “低配置高稳定” 的特性对服务器配置提出了特殊要求。本文将从硬件选型、带宽规划、软件环境、安全防护和性能调校五个维度,全面解析复古传奇私人服务器的服务器配置方案,助你搭建稳定流畅的游戏环境。
硬件配置:按玩家规模分级选型
复古传奇私人服务器的硬件配置需遵循 “精准匹配” 原则,根据预期同时在线人数制定分级方案。对于 50 人以内的小型私人服务器,入门级配置即可满足需求:CPU 选择 Intel G640 或同级别处理器,其单核性能足以应对复古版本的计算需求;内存配备 4GB DDR3,能够保证服务端程序与数据库的稳定运行;硬盘采用 120GB SSD,显著提升地图文件加载速度和数据库读写效率。这种配置的优势在于成本可控,初期硬件投入可控制在千元以内,适合个人或小型团队起步。
当同时在线人数达到 100-200 人时,硬件配置需进行阶梯式升级。CPU 应选用 Intel i3-10100 或 AMD Ryzen 3 3200G,四核四线程设计能有效处理多玩家同时操作的并发请求;内存升级至 8GB DDR4,为服务端预留足够的缓存空间,减少因内存不足导致的卡顿;硬盘可扩展至 240GB SSD,并建议开启 TRIM 功能,维持长期使用的读写性能。实测表明,这种配置在石墓阵等多怪物场景中,能将玩家操作响应时间控制在 200 毫秒以内,明显优于入门级配置。
针对 200 人以上的中大型私人服务器,硬件配置需构建 “均衡性能” 体系。CPU 推荐 Intel i5-10400 或 AMD Ryzen 5 5600G,六核十二线程的规格可应对高强度的数据处理需求;内存容量提升至 16GB DDR4,采用双通道架构进一步提升数据吞吐量;硬盘配置 512GB SSD 并组建 RAID10 阵列,既保证读写速度又实现数据冗余备份。特别需要注意的是,复古版本对显卡无特殊要求,集成显卡即可满足图形渲染需求,无需额外配备独立显卡,这也是复古传奇的硬件成本优势所在。
硬件配置的兼容性验证不可忽视。所有硬件组合需通过实际测试,重点检查 CPU 与主板的兼容性、内存频率匹配度以及 SSD 与主板接口的兼容性。建议在正式运营前进行 72 小时压力测试,模拟 200 人同时在线的场景,监测 CPU 使用率、内存占用和硬盘 I/O 等关键指标,确保峰值状态下各项参数均保持在安全阈值内(CPU 使用率低于 80%,内存占用低于 70%)。
带宽规划:上传优先的网络架构
复古传奇私人服务器的带宽需求具有鲜明特点 —— 上传速度比下载速度更为关键。游戏数据的传输模式决定了服务器需要持续向玩家客户端推送地图信息、怪物状态和玩家操作反馈等数据,这些均依赖上传带宽。实测数据显示,每 100 名同时在线玩家需要 8-10Mbps 的上传带宽,200 人则需 15-20Mbps,以此类推。例如在沙巴克攻城等大规模团战场景中,瞬时数据传输量会激增,建议预留 30% 的带宽冗余,避免因带宽饱和导致的集体卡顿。
带宽类型的选择直接影响游戏体验。单线机房(如仅电信或联通)适合目标用户集中在单一网络运营商覆盖区域的私人服务器;而 BGP 多线机房则能自动匹配玩家的网络线路,显著降低跨网延迟,适合面向全国玩家的私人服务器。对于 1.76 复古版本,ping 值控制在 50 毫秒以内时玩家几乎无感知延迟,100 毫秒以内属于可接受范围,超过 150 毫秒则会出现明显的技能释放延迟,这也是选择优质机房的重要标准。
带宽成本的优化需要科学计算。中小私人服务器可采用 “基础带宽 + 弹性带宽” 的付费模式,例如 200 人规模私人服务器可购置 20Mbps 基础带宽,同时开通弹性带宽功能,在攻城等高峰时段自动提升至 30Mbps,既能保证体验又能控制成本。需要注意的是,不同机房的带宽单价差异较大,一线城市机房带宽成本较高但稳定性更好,二三线城市机房成本较低但需严格测试其网络稳定性。
网络架构的细节设计影响稳定性。服务器应配备独立 IP 地址,避免与其他服务器共享 IP 导致的风险;DNS 解析推荐使用阿里云或腾讯云的 DNS 服务,提高解析速度和稳定性;有条件的私人服务器可部署 CDN 加速静态资源(如登录界面、背景音乐等),减轻主服务器的带宽压力。这些措施虽不直接提升游戏运行速度,但能显著改善玩家的登录体验和操作流畅度。
软件环境:兼容性优先的系统配置
操作系统的选择需以兼容性为核心。复古传奇服务端程序多基于早期 Windows 系统开发,实践证明 Windows Server 2012 R2 是兼容性最佳的选择,既能支持现代硬件驱动,又能完美运行 1.76 等经典版本的服务端程序。不推荐使用 Windows Server 2016 及以上版本,可能出现部分老版本服务端组件无法运行的问题;而 Windows XP 等老旧系统则缺乏必要的安全更新,存在较大安全隐患。
系统环境的基础配置有明确规范。安装系统时需格式化硬盘为 NTFS 文件系统,预留至少 20GB 的系统分区空间;关闭自动更新和系统还原功能,避免更新过程中重启服务器;禁用不必要的服务(如 Windows Search、Remote Desktop 等),释放系统资源。建议安装 DirectX 9.0c 运行库,确保游戏特效正常显示,这对复古版本的画面表现至关重要。
数据库配置是数据存储的核心。复古传奇私人服务器常用 MySQL 作为数据库管理系统,版本选择 5.5 或 5.6 最为稳定,高版本可能存在兼容性问题。关键参数设置如下:innodb_buffer_pool_size 设为服务器内存的 50%-60%,提升数据缓存能力;max_connections 设为预计同时在线人数的 2-3 倍(如 200 人服设为 500),避免连接数不足;启用慢查询日志,定期分析并优化耗时查询语句。数据库文件建议单独存放于 SSD 分区,减少读写延迟。
服务端程序的部署有严格路径要求。主程序 M2Server.exe 需放置在根目录(如 D:\MirServer\),其依赖的 Data、Map 等文件夹必须保持相对路径正确;DBSrv200 和 LogSrv 等组件需安装在 Mud2 目录下,确保角色数据和登录日志正常记录;登录网关(LoginGate)需正确配置 IP 地址和端口,默认端口为 7000,如需修改需同步更新客户端登录器设置。部署完成后需逐一启动各组件,检查日志文件确认无错误信息。
安全防护:多层设防的防御体系
基础防护从服务器端口管理开始。复古传奇服务端仅需开放必要端口:7000(登录端口)、7100(游戏端口)、3306(MySQL 数据库端口,建议仅本地访问),其他端口一律关闭。通过 Windows 防火墙设置入站规则,精确限制允许访问的 IP 范围,特别是数据库端口应禁止外部网络访问。定期检查开放端口状态,使用端口扫描工具验证防护效果,避免因误操作开放危险端口。
DDoS 攻击防护是私人服务器运营的必备措施。针对传奇私人服务器常见的 SYN Flood 和 UDP Flood 攻击,需部署硬件防火墙或接入抗 DDoS 服务,这类攻击通过海量虚假数据包占用带宽和服务器资源,导致正常玩家无法连接。专业抗 D 服务提供商(如知道创宇)的防护系统能智能识别攻击流量并过滤,其 Nightwatch Anti-CC 引擎可有效防御针对登录页面的 CC 攻击,这类攻击通过模拟正常玩家登录消耗服务器资源。对于中小私人服务器,接入基础抗 D 服务(防护能力 10-20Gbps)即可应对大部分攻击。
数据安全需建立多重备份机制。玩家数据是私人服务器的核心资产,应采用 “实时备份 + 定时备份” 相结合的方式:通过 MySQL 主从复制实现实时数据同步,将从库作为热备份;每日凌晨执行全量备份,将数据库文件和角色数据压缩后存储至异地服务器或云存储(如阿里云 OSS)。备份文件需定期验证完整性,确保紧急情况下可快速恢复。同时启用服务端自带的日志功能,记录所有关键操作(如物品交易、账号登录),便于追溯异常行为。
账号安全防护需从程序层面强化。在服务端配置中启用密码加密存储,禁止明文保存玩家密码;限制同一 IP 的登录尝试次数,防止暴力破解;对异常登录行为(如异地登录、短时间多次登录)进行提醒或临时限制。这些措施虽增加一定配置工作量,但能有效降低账号被盗引发的玩家流失风险,维护私人服务器的信誉和口碑。
性能调校:细节优化的稳定之道
服务端参数的精准设置直接影响运行效率。在 M2Server 配置文件中,将 “最大在线人数” 设为实际承载能力的 80%(如硬件支持 200 人则设为 160),预留缓冲空间;“地图怪物数量上限” 根据地图大小合理设置,比奇城等主城可适当降低,石墓阵等刷怪地图可提高;“物品掉落频率” 采用默认值即可,过高会增加数据库写入压力。这些参数需通过多次测试调整,找到性能与玩法体验的平衡点。
数据库的定期维护不可或缺。每周执行一次数据库优化,使用 OPTIMIZE TABLE 语句优化数据表结构,减少碎片空间;每月检查索引使用情况,为频繁查询的字段(如玩家 ID、角色名)建立合适索引;根据数据量增长情况,适时扩大数据库文件存储空间。对于运营超过 6 个月的私人服务器,建议进行一次全面的数据清理,删除长期不活跃账号数据,提升查询效率。
服务器资源的监控需常态化。安装资源监控工具(如 Windows Performance Monitor),实时监测 CPU 使用率、内存占用、磁盘 I/O 和网络带宽等指标,设置关键指标的告警阈值(如 CPU 持续 5 分钟超过 90% 即触发告警)。通过分析监控数据,可及时发现性能瓶颈,例如内存占用持续攀升可能是内存泄漏导致,需检查服务端程序或重启服务器。
系统级的优化措施能进一步提升稳定性。将服务器电源管理设置为 “高性能” 模式,避免 CPU 自动降频影响性能;关闭硬盘休眠功能,减少数据读取延迟;定期清理系统垃圾文件和临时文件,保持磁盘空间充足(建议剩余空间不低于总容量的 20%)。这些细节优化虽单次效果有限,但长期坚持能显著提升服务器的稳定性和响应速度。
服务器选型:性价比导向的部署方案
云服务器是中小私人服务器的理想选择。主流云服务商(如阿里云、腾讯云)提供的弹性云服务器可按需配置,2 核 4GB 内存、50GB SSD 硬盘、20Mbps 带宽的配置足以支撑 200 人以内的私人服务器运营,月成本约 300-500 元。云服务器的优势在于无需自行维护硬件,支持一键重启和故障迁移,且可根据玩家增长随时升级配置。选择云服务器时需注意选择支持 Windows Server 2012 R2 的实例,避免兼容性问题。
独立服务器适合中大型私人服务器长期运营。当同时在线人数稳定在 300 人以上时,推荐租用独立服务器:配置参考 Intel i5 处理器、16GB 内存、1TB SSD、50Mbps 带宽,月租金约 1500-2500 元。独立服务器的优势在于性能稳定、资源独占,可根据需求灵活配置硬件和网络。选择机房时优先考虑具有高防能力的服务商,减少攻击导致的停机风险。
服务器托管与自建机房的对比需理性看待。服务器托管是将自有服务器放置在专业机房,享受机房的网络和电力保障,适合有技术能力维护硬件的团队;自建机房则需要承担场地、电力、空调等额外成本,且网络质量难以保证,仅推荐规模较大的私人服务器运营团队考虑。对于绝大多数复古传奇私人服务器运营者,云服务器或独立服务器租用是性价比更高的选择。
服务器配置的升级路线应提前规划。建议采用 “小步快跑” 的升级策略:初期从 200 人配置起步,当连续一周在线人数超过承载能力的 70% 时进行升级;首次升级可优先增加内存和带宽,这两个组件对性能提升最明显;后续再根据需求升级 CPU 和硬盘。每次升级后需进行全面测试,确保新配置与服务端程序兼容,避免出现 “高配置低性能” 的情况。
搭建复古传奇私人服务器的服务器配置,本质是在成本与体验之间寻找平衡。1.76 等经典版本的特性决定了其不需要最顶级的硬件,而是需要精准匹配的配置和细致的优化调校。从 50 人小服的入门配置到数百人规模的稳定运行,每一步都需要结合玩家增长数据和实际运行表现进行调整。记住,最稳定的服务器配置不是最贵的配置,而是经过充分测试、持续优化、与玩家规模完美匹配的配置。遵循本文的配置原则和实践方法,你的复古传奇私人服务器将能为玩家提供流畅稳定的游戏体验,在玛法大陆的竞争中赢得一席之地。